Transaction 137458989682cb710332e61bf3b1a241c4453aee03561df00938e885870cf261
1 Input
1 Output
-
137458989682cb710332e61bf3b1a241c4453aee03561df00938e885870cf261:0
- value
- 32627930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81ebcc6759111e9ee1a5b32d8fb81b14c44a2397 OP_EQUAL
- address
- 3DXyZrTaFW5uThfqssDEUwjVrwokAWQ4Sz